Hi everyone. I'm new to the boards and would love some advice from anyone who has been through what I am now. I have been a single parent for 3 years and had no serious relationship during this time. I have met someone new and things are going great but it's a bit difficult as I have 2 kids daughter 7 & son 4 yrs and until I have introduced them to my new partner I am having to keep them and him apart only seeing him when the kids are with their dad. I want to introduce them so I can see more of partner. How long should I leave it before introducing the kids to him and any recommendations on how to go about it would be greatly appreciated. I am not the sort of person to have lots of different men in my kids lives this man is special!the kids do have regular contact with their dad and I wonder if I should tell him about my new partner or not and should I tell him before I tell the kids? Please help Thanks

Talk to them and find out how they feel. Slowly start mentioning his name and sharing lovely stories about him. When they ask where you have been while they were away tell them the truth. After a while you can say , would you like to meet him and presto bobs your uncle. Then i wouldn't bother being touchy feely for a bit and act like your mates until they connect with him.

Hello bit different for me i guess as my DD is only 3 but ive been single since she was born till before xmas. my new partner is fantastic, he hasnt got kids and i was very unsure about introducing him. i was very slow to introduce him and just did it step by step. we all went out for a walk initially so she could have her own space and she was fine with him from then on. now has to speak to him when he is away on business before sh goes to bed etc. i am quite amazed seeing as she has not had a father figure in the past. just do what feels right. good luck
